Here are the general
admission requirements for an Associate Degree, Diploma or Certificate
Program:
Step 1--Submit
a completed application and the $15.00 application fee
(Georgia Virtual Technical College students must apply on the GVTC website,
www.gvtc.org
. Follow instructions under the heading "Student Services").
Step 2--Submit
an official copy of your high school *transcript or GED scores to the
Admissions Office. (Transcript request forms are available in the
Admissions Office.);
*Transcripts must be
from an institution accredited by the Georgia Accrediting Commission, a
regional accreditation agency (SACS, etc.), the Accreditation
Commission for Independent Study (ACIS), or the Georgia Private School
Accreditation Council (GAPSAC).
Step 3--Submit
an official copy of all postsecondary transcripts to the Admissions Office.
(Transcript request forms are available in the Admissions Office.);
Step 4--Take the
placement test. Southeastern Technical College assesses students with either
the Asset or Compass placement test, by ACT. Asset is a paper and pencil

In
lieu of the placement test, official scores on the SAT may be substituted.
For diplomas, 430 verbal and 400 math or ACT scores of 18 English and 16 for
math may be submitted. You may also submit CPE scores of 75-Math,
75-Reading, and 75-English. For degree programs, SAT scores of 480 verbal
and 440 math; ACT scores of 25 verbal and 21 math; or CPE scores of
75-Reading, 75-English, and 79-Math may be used. These scores may be
accepted provided that they are no more than five years old. Official
transcripts from a regionally accredited postsecondary institution
documenting successful completion (a grade of “C” or better) in equivalent,
program-level English and Math courses may be submitted in lieu of taking
the placement test. Reasonable accommodations are made during testing for
those who need them. (Please notify the Special Needs Specialist to
schedule a test date.)
NOTE:
Certain certificate
programs do not require a high school diploma, GED, or placement test
scores. Placement tests are not required for special admit
(non-diploma/non-credit) students unless recommended by the Admissions
Office. This recommendation will be based on educational data listed on the
Application for Admission. Contact the Admission Office for details.
